On the back foot
Date published: 27 August 2010
RUNNERS get the race with a difference under way.
ATHLETICS: TWO local runners took a step in a different direction by competing in the first ever UK Backward Running Championships.
David Emanuel from Littleborough and Middleton’s Chris Eavers, members of Royton Road Runners, successfully negotiated a hilly one-mile course at Heaton Park to come sixth and ninth respectively.
Ireland’s Garret Doherty won the curious competition, hot on the heels of his gold medal at the World Backward Running Championships in Austria.
